Saurya Airlines crash: Captain Manish Shakya survives



KATHMANDU: Captain Manish Shakya, who miraculously survived the tragic shipwreck of the Saurya Airlines on Wednesday morning, is currently undergoing intensive care treatment (ICU) at Kathmandu Medical College (KMC) in Sinamangal.

According to SSP Dineshraj Mainali, spokesperson of the Kathmandu Valley Police Office, Shakya is conscious and able to communicate.

The incident claimed the lives of 18 out of the 19 individuals aboard.

Police have recovered the bodies of the deceased and transported them to Tribhuvan University Teaching Hospital (TUTH) for post-mortem.

The crash, which occurred on Wednesday morning at 11:11 a.m., prompted an immediate response from fire departments, security personnel, and emergency services for search and rescue operations.
